the best defense is awareness, IMO.. they make RFID card holders and wallets that protect from skimming, but that won't necessarily protect someone from gaining access to the records where you've spent your money. there have been skimmers on gas pumps, ATM's, debit/credit machines at grocery stores, etc.. then there are handheld RFID skimmers that someone else mentioned that only need to come within a decent proximity to grab that information.
